How Water Damage Cleaning Functions: A Comprehensive Overview for Homeowners



Water damages can posture significant challenges for homeowners, necessitating a clear understanding of the cleaning process to properly alleviate threats. It is important to examine the degree of the damage and determine the source of the water intrusion.


Evaluating the Damage



When faced with water damage, the first critical action is analyzing the level of the damages. A complete examination includes determining the source of the water breach, which can vary from a burst pipe to all-natural flooding. Comprehending the origin helps determine the essential removal steps. Next, evaluate the impacted areas for noticeable indications of damage, such as staining, bending, or mold development. Pay close interest to flooring, wall surfaces, and ceilings, as these products are particularly at risk to wetness.


In addition, it is necessary to evaluate the period of exposure to water. Materials that have actually been wet for an extensive period are most likely to sustain a lot more severe damages and might need substitute instead of repair service. Documenting the damage with pictures can offer beneficial evidence for insurance policy claims and repair professionals.


Finally, take into consideration the potential health and wellness threats related to water damages, consisting of the growth of mold and mildew and impurities. This assessment not only help in creating a response method yet also guarantees the safety and security of inhabitants. By systematically examining the damages, homeowners can better comprehend the range of the concern and plan for the subsequent steps in the clean-up procedure.


Water Elimination Strategies



Reliable water elimination is essential in reducing damages and stopping more concerns such as mold and mildew growth. The very first step in this process involves determining the source of water invasion, which might be from flooding, leaks, or other aspects. When the resource is addressed, various techniques can be employed for effective water removal.


One common method is using completely submersible pumps, which are ideal for removing standing water in bigger locations. These pumps can successfully remove considerable volumes of water quickly. For smaller, more confined areas, wet/dry vacuums are typically utilized to handle residual moisture properly.

Drying and Dehumidification



Effective drying and dehumidification are essential components in the recuperation process complying with water damage. When the first water removal has actually been finished, the focus moves to thoroughly drying the influenced areas to stop more issues such as mold and mildew development and structural damages.

Monitoring wetness degrees throughout this phase is important. Specialists use wetness meters to assess the efficiency of drying out initiatives and guarantee that all products, consisting of wall surfaces, floorings, and furnishings, are effectively dried out. In many emergency water leak repair cases, thermal imaging cams might also be utilized to find surprise moisture pockets within walls or ceilings.


Normally, the drying out procedure can take several days to complete, depending upon the degree of the water damages and ecological problems. Effectively executed drying and dehumidification not only secure your property but also pave the way for subsequent cleaning and remediation efforts.




Cleaning and Sterilizing



Cleaning up and sterilizing are necessary action in the water damages remediation process, as they guarantee that impacted areas are without contaminants and pathogens. After drying and dehumidification, the cleansing stage entails the elimination of debris, dirt, and any recurring dampness that might harbor damaging bacteria. It is essential to use proper cleaner that can effectively eliminate germs, mold and mildew spores, and other prospective risks.


Professional-grade disinfectants are often used to make certain complete sanitization. These products should be used according to maker directions, considering variables such as get in touch with time and dilution rates. Unique interest should be offered to permeable materials, such as carpetings and drywall, which may call for specific cleaning strategies or replacement if greatly polluted.


Furthermore, high-touch surface areas, such as light switches and doorknobs, ought to be focused on throughout the cleaning process to lessen wellness risks. By carefully cleansing and disinfecting water-damaged areas, property owners can dramatically reduce the risk of mold development and make certain a secure environment for residents.


Stopping Future Concerns



Homeowners' watchfulness is important in protecting against future water damages concerns. Regular maintenance of plumbing systems is important; this includes checking for leaks, rust, and guaranteeing that seals around sinks, bathrooms, and tubs stay undamaged. Furthermore, checking roof covering seamless gutters and downspouts regularly can prevent water from pooling near the structure, which might bring about substantial water breach.


Correct landscape design is one more vital element. Guarantee that the ground slopes away from your home's structure to promote water drainage. Think about setting up a French drain or sump pump in locations vulnerable to flooding.


Moreover, be positive in keeping track of humidity degrees inside your home. Making use of dehumidifiers in moist areas, such as cellars and creep areas, can significantly lower the threat of mold growth and architectural damage.




Finally, buy high quality products and technologies, such as water leakage discovery systems, which can notify you to concerns before they intensify. By applying these preventative steps, home owners can significantly minimize the chance of future water damages, securing their residential or commercial property and maintaining its worth. Regular evaluations and a dedication to upkeep will offer tranquility of mind and defense versus unforeseen water-related catastrophes.
